Which one of the following is used as a Piezoelectric material?

A

Silicones

B

Graphite

C

Silica Gel

D

Quartz

Text Solution

AI Generated Solution

The correct Answer is:
To determine which material is used as a piezoelectric material, we can follow these steps: ### Step 1: Understand the Definition of Piezoelectric Materials A piezoelectric material is one that generates an electric current when subjected to mechanical stress. This phenomenon is known as the piezoelectric effect. **Hint:** Remember that the key characteristic of piezoelectric materials is their ability to convert mechanical energy into electrical energy. ### Step 2: Identify the Mechanism Behind the Piezoelectric Effect When mechanical stress is applied to a piezoelectric material, the positive and negative charge centers within the material shift. This shift creates an electric field, which in turn generates an electric current. **Hint:** Focus on the relationship between mechanical stress and the movement of charge centers in the material. ### Step 3: Consider Examples of Piezoelectric Materials One common example of a piezoelectric material is quartz. Quartz is known for its durability and heat resistance, making it suitable for various electronic applications. **Hint:** Think about materials that are commonly used in electronics and have properties that allow them to withstand stress. ### Step 4: Analyze the Options Provided If the question provides multiple options, compare each option against the characteristics of piezoelectric materials. In this case, we conclude that quartz is a well-known piezoelectric material. **Hint:** Look for materials that are frequently mentioned in the context of electronics and mechanical applications. ### Conclusion Based on the understanding of piezoelectric materials and the example provided, we can confidently state that quartz is a piezoelectric material. **Final Answer:** Quartz is used as a piezoelectric material.
